青海省市场监管局深化企业首席质量官制度为高原特色产业发展注入新动能
Core Viewpoint - The implementation of the Chief Quality Officer (CQO) system in Qinghai Province is a key strategy to enhance the quality competitiveness of enterprises and support the construction of a modern quality development framework in the region [1]. Group 1: Implementation of the CQO System - The Qinghai Provincial Market Supervision Administration has prioritized the promotion of the CQO system as a key task for 2025, encouraging large-scale enterprises to establish CQOs and integrate them into quality improvement and incentive assessment systems [1]. - As of now, 308 enterprises in the province have appointed CQOs, and 338 individuals have obtained training certificates [1]. Group 2: Training and Capacity Building - A layered and categorized training program is being conducted across the province, utilizing resources from the "CQO Home" platform and the Provincial Quality Association, focusing on quality strategy, excellence performance, and digital quality management [2]. - Various training methods, including theory and case studies, are being employed to enhance the practical management skills of CQOs [2]. Group 3: Successful Practices and Innovations - Notable examples of successful CQO practices include: - Qinghai Salt Lake Yuanpin Chemical's CQO led a QC initiative that increased the urea premium product rate to 85.46% [2]. - Gelmud Yilin Goji's CQO established a traceable system for organic goji berries, achieving 17 years of zero quality accidents and accounting for half of the province's export value [2]. - Zhongfu Shenying Carbon Fiber's CQO developed a comprehensive quality management system with an annual key performance indicator improvement rate exceeding 5% [2]. - China General Nuclear Power's CQO innovated a full lifecycle management model for heat transfer oil in solar thermal power plants, achieving 230 days of continuous operation [2]. Group 4: Future Directions - The Qinghai Provincial Market Supervision Administration plans to deepen the CQO system's implementation, focusing on effective coverage in small and micro enterprises and enhancing the strategic decision-making and cross-departmental collaboration capabilities of CQOs [3]. - An incentive mechanism will be improved to stimulate the innovative potential of CQOs, contributing to higher quality development in Qinghai [3].
打造企地协同发展“同心模式”
Jin Rong Shi Bao· 2025-11-27 05:11
Core Insights - The article highlights the transformative impact of China National Nuclear Corporation (CNNC) in Tongxin County, Ningxia, showcasing a successful model of targeted poverty alleviation and rural revitalization through strategic investments and partnerships [1][10] Investment and Economic Development - Since 2013, CNNC has invested a total of 3.9 billion yuan in Tongxin County, facilitating a transition from poverty alleviation to rural revitalization [1] - The establishment of Zhonghe (Ningxia) Tongxin Protective Technology Co., Ltd. has led to the creation of over 1,600 stable jobs, directly benefiting more than 300 families [3][2] - The company has expanded from 3 production lines in 2018 to 9 lines, achieving an annual output value exceeding 80 million yuan [3] Agricultural Advancements - The county has developed a standardized and modernized organic goji berry planting base, with a total planting area of 60,000 mu and an annual output value of 300 million yuan [4] - The average yield of dried goji berries is 150 kg per mu, with a loan balance for the goji industry reaching 85.3 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 12.3% [4] Livestock and Financial Support - CNNC has invested 300,000 yuan to establish a standardized beef cattle breeding park in Dantianling Village, contributing to the standardized and industrialized development of livestock farming [6] - The total loans for beef cattle breeding in Tongxin County reached 2.34 billion yuan, with a year-on-year increase of 15.4% [6] Renewable Energy Initiatives - CNNC established Zhonghe (Ningxia) Tongxin New Energy Co., Ltd. in 2019, focusing on renewable energy projects, including the first distributed photovoltaic project in Ningxia with a loan of 192 million yuan [8] - The photovoltaic power station has improved land utilization by 60% and doubled farmers' income [8] Community and Environmental Impact - The "Tongxin Model" has led to significant improvements in local living conditions, with the introduction of clean energy projects creating nearly 1,000 stable jobs [9] - The integration of renewable energy with agricultural practices has enhanced both economic and environmental sustainability in the region [9] Long-term Strategy and Vision - CNNC's approach emphasizes long-term, systematic planning for sustainable development, focusing on "industry-led + strategic cooperation" to foster high-quality growth in Tongxin County [10]
省部共建 青海绿色有机农畜产品输出地建设成果显著
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2025-11-05 12:02
Core Insights - The meeting held on November 5 in Xining focused on the construction of Qinghai as a green organic agricultural and livestock product output area, highlighting significant achievements since the initiative began in 2021 [1][3] - Qinghai has established itself as the largest production base for organic livestock products, organic goji berries, and cold-water fish in China, with a notable increase in export capabilities and brand influence [1][3] Summary by Categories Achievements - Since the launch of the output area construction, Qinghai has built the largest organic livestock product, organic goji berry, and cold-water fish production bases in the country [1] - The province has also developed national-level spring rapeseed and potato seed production bases, achieving historic breakthroughs in the export of specialty agricultural products [1][3] Economic Impact - During the 14th Five-Year Plan period, Qinghai's green organic agricultural and livestock products reached a total of 1,621, with cumulative output exceeding 3.248 million tons, generating a value of 55.91 billion yuan [3] - The rapid transformation and upgrading of specialty industries have provided strong momentum for the modernization of agriculture and rural revitalization in Qinghai [3] Government Support - The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s has supported Qinghai's green organic industry development through fee reductions, totaling 21.86 million yuan over five years [3] - Future support will focus on accelerating the development of agricultural product quality standards, encouraging green organic certification, and enhancing agricultural technology platforms [3]

进出口增速全国第一!青海外贸如何跑出“加速度”?记者探访→
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-09-21 15:26
Core Insights - China's foreign trade structure continues to optimize, with the central and western regions showing higher growth rates, releasing foreign trade potential [1] - In the first eight months of this year, the total import and export value of the central and western regions reached over 5 trillion yuan, marking a historical high for the same period [1] - Qinghai province leads the nation with a 45% year-on-year growth in foreign trade [1][9] Group 1: Qinghai's Export Growth - Qinghai's foreign trade import and export value reached 48.1 billion yuan from January to August, with a year-on-year growth of 45%, the highest in the country [9] - The province's agricultural product exports have seen continuous growth for nine consecutive quarters, with 96 types of agricultural products exported, an increase of 55 types compared to the previous year [11] - Notable exports include frozen trout valued at 290 million yuan, a 130% increase, and goji berries valued at 14.814 million yuan, up 28.8% [11] Group 2: Industry Strategies - Companies in Qinghai are shifting from domestic sales to international markets by adjusting their strategies for different overseas markets [3] - The goji berry industry is focusing on high-end and organic products to avoid homogenization and increase export value [5] - Organic goji berries command a price premium of 10 to 20 yuan per kilogram compared to regular ones, resulting in a profit margin increase of about 10% [7] Group 3: Broader Regional Trends - More unique agricultural products from central and western regions are successfully entering international markets, including Sichuan's Tibetan fragrant pork and Gansu's seabuckthorn juice [13]
央企消费帮扶购物节活动启动
Zhong Guo Dian Li Bao· 2025-05-28 02:00
Core Viewpoint - The event "Qinghai Source Power, Rural Renewal Journey" shopping festival aims to enhance the market competitiveness and brand influence of agricultural products from supported areas, thereby helping local farmers increase their income through a combination of online and offline activities [1][2]. Group 1: Event Overview - The shopping festival was launched in Xining, Qinghai, with the support of various state-owned enterprises and local government agencies [1]. - The event features over a thousand types of specialty agricultural products, including organic goji berries, black barley, and highland quinoa, showcased by suppliers from eight cities in Qinghai and 43 central government-supported counties [1]. Group 2: Sales and Promotion Activities - During the festival, participating units organized online live broadcasts and promotions to expand sales channels and improve efficiency [2]. - The National Energy Group utilized its e-commerce platforms to promote excellent agricultural products from nine counties, collaborating with JD.com for a special live broadcast event [2]. Group 3: Social Responsibility and Investment - The National Energy Group has committed to rural revitalization as a key area of social responsibility, focusing on poverty alleviation and sustainable development in the nine counties [2]. - As of 2024, the National Energy Group has invested a total of 2.66 billion yuan in these counties, supporting over 1,300 projects in various sectors including industry, education, and ecological protection [2].
